US President Donald Trump’s ambassadors Steve Witkoff and Jared Kushner met with Russian President Vladimir Putin in Moscow as part of a diplomatic tour that includes Kiev and aims to end the war in Ukraine.

On Saturday, Putin called contacts between Moscow and Washington “always fruitful” and expressed his country’s satisfaction with cooperation with Vitkov and Kushner.

Vitkov said that Trump had sent his greetings to Putin and thanked him for ending the strikes during the visit of the American delegation, while the Russian president stressed that his country would do everything to ensure the safety of the ambassadors.

Russia and Ukraine announced a three-day freeze on strikes on Moscow and Kiev, coinciding with a visit by US ambassadors to the two capitals in Washington’s latest attempt to end the war.

Kremlin spokesman Dmitry Peskov told the official TASS news agency that the decision to suspend the strikes was made “as part of preparations for the contacts that the Americans will make in Kiev.”
